Web Access is Fine, But Otherwise Can't Use Internet

I have no problem accessing websites using IE6, but suddenly I can't connect directly to remote computers, such as my company's email server or an online gaming site. When I try to connect, I eventually get a message that it cannot connect to the remote computer. Norton Antivirus, AdAware and Spybot find no problems. What can I do? | |

all website using only port 80. 1. Did you have any firewall(hardware or software)? By Default SP2 enabled the firewall feature and if you're not configure it properly you may not able to do anything beside web surfing. Or try to disable all firewall(norton, windows build in firewall) and see if that help? |
